How much do at home rn jobs pay per week?

As of Jul 4, 2026, the average weekly pay for at home rn in Manchester, NH is $1,947.63,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$1,523.08 and $2,278.85 per week,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by At Home RNs, and how can they effectively manage them?

At Home Registered Nurses (RNs) often encounter challenges such as working independently without immediate access to colleagues, managing diverse patient needs in non-clinical environments, and adapting to varying home conditions. To effectively manage these challenges, At Home RNs should maintain strong communication with their healthcare team, utilize telehealth tools for support, and stay organized with thorough documentation. Building rapport with patients and their families is also crucial to ensure smooth care delivery and address any concerns promptly.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an At Home RN, and why are they important?

To thrive as an At Home RN, you need strong clinical assessment skills, nursing credentials (such as an active RN license), and experience in home health care. Familiarity with telehealth platforms, remote patient monitoring systems, and electronic health records is typically required. Exceptional communication, independence, and time management are vital soft skills for working autonomously and supporting patients in their own environments. These competencies ensure safe, effective care delivery and foster trust while adapting to the unique challenges of home-based nursing.

What are At Home RNs?

At Home RNs, also known as home health registered nurses, are licensed nurses who provide medical care to patients in their own homes. They typically assist patients recovering from illness, surgery, or injury, and may also care for those with chronic health conditions. Their responsibilities include administering medications, monitoring vital signs, educating patients and their families, and coordinating with other healthcare professionals. At Home RNs help ensure patients receive quality care outside of a traditional hospital or clinic setting, promoting recovery and independence.

Your Responsibilities as a PRN RN:

As a Home Health Registered Nurse, you will manage a caseload of patients and provide comprehensive nursing care throughout their healthcare journey.

Responsibilities include:

* Completing skilled nursing assessments and developing individualized plans of care
* Performing admissions, routine visits, recertifications, and discharge visits
* Evaluating patients' physical, psychosocial, environmental, and educational needs
* Coordinating care with physicians, caregivers, and interdisciplinary team members
* Monitoring patient progress and identifying changes in condition
* Updating and revising care plans to ensure optimal outcomes
* Educating patients and families on disease management, medications, and self-care techniques
* Maintaining accurate and timely clinical documentation
* Helping prevent avoidable hospitalizations through proactive intervention and patient education
* Delivering compassionate, patient-centered care while promoting safety and independence

Qualifications:

* Current, unrestricted Massachusetts Registered Nurse (RN) license
* Minimum of one (1) year of nursing experience in a clinical care setting
* Ability to commit to at least one full day (8 hours) per week
* Valid driver's license, reliable transportation, and current auto insurance
* Willingness to travel throughout the assigned territory

* Previous Home Health experience strongly preferred
* Hospice experience preferred
* Experience with HomeCare HomeBase (HCHB) preferred
* Associate or Bachelor's Degree in Nursing

* Physical Requirements -Sit, stand, bend, lift and move intermittently and be able to lift 50-100 lbs.
